What are the legal requirements for renewing a lease contract in Bolivia?

In Bolivia, the renewal of a lease contract is subject to certain legal requirements, which may vary depending on the provisions of the contract and applicable legislation. Some common requirements may include: 1) Mutual consent: Both the landlord and tenant must agree to renew the lease and the terms of the proposed renewal. 2) Written notification: The landlord must notify the tenant in writing of his intention to renew the lease with a minimum notice period before the end of the term of the existing contract. Similarly, the tenant can also notify the landlord in writing of his desire to renew the contract. 3) Conditions of renewal: The conditions of renewal, such as the amount of rent and the duration of the contract, must be agreed upon by both parties and documented in writing in a renewed lease. 4) Registration of the renewed contract: If necessary according to the applicable legal provisions, the renewed lease contract can be registered with the competent authorities for its legal validity. It is important that both parties comply with these requirements to ensure a legal and valid renewal of the lease contract in Bolivia.

Are there specific regulations for regulatory compliance in the financial sector of Costa Rica?

Yes, in the financial sector of Costa Rica there are specific regulations for regulatory compliance. Financial institutions are subject to strict regulations, including the Organic Law of the National Banking System and the regulations issued by the General Superintendence of Financial Entities (SUGEF). Regulatory compliance in the financial sector is essential to protect the stability of the financial system.

What are the opportunities for the development of the ecotourism industry in Bolivia, despite possible restrictions on international promotion due to embargoes?

Despite possible restrictions on international promotion due to embargoes, there are opportunities for the development of the ecotourism industry in Bolivia. Diversifying sustainable tourism offerings that highlight the country's unique biodiversity can attract tourists committed to conservation. Collaborating with environmental organizations and adopting responsible tourism practices can generate positive recognition. Investment in eco-friendly infrastructure and environmental education programs for visitors can improve the ecotourism experience. Participation in specialized tourism fairs and events at the national and international level, as well as the creation of alliances with international tour operators, are effective strategies. Additionally, promoting government policies that encourage ecotourism and raising awareness about the importance of conservation can contribute to the sustainable growth of the industry in Bolivia.

What is the process to notify an early termination of the contract by the lessee in Chile?

To provide notice of an early termination of the lease, the tenant generally must provide written notice to the landlord 30, 60, or 90 days in advance, depending on the lease or local law.

Can background checks include reviewing candidates' online reputation in Colombia?

Yes, checks may include reviewing online reputation. However, it is important to do it ethically and respect the privacy of the candidates, avoiding decisions based solely on information from social networks.

What is the process to sanction a contractor in Mexico?

The process of sanctioning a contractor in Mexico generally begins with an investigation by the competent authority, followed by a legal process where it is determined whether regulations have been violated. If found guilty, appropriate sanctions apply.
